Call for Submissions – Voices and Visibility: Women, Art, and Political Change

2026 Annual Juried Exhibition at Kawartha Art Gallery

Call for Submissions
Voices and Visibility: Women, Art, and Political Change

Submission Deadline: Monday, September 28, 2026, by midnight ET
Artwork Delivery Deadline: Thursday, October 1, 2026, 11am–8pm
Exhibition Dates: October 7 – December 19, 2026
Awards Reception: Saturday, November 7, 2026, 2–4pm

Democracy thrives when all people can participate, contribute, and have their voices heard.

Throughout history, women have played a vital role in expanding rights, advocating for change, building communities, and shaping the democratic landscape.

Kawartha Art Gallery invites artists to explore the relationship between women, participation, and democracy through an exhibition that explores the power of civic engagement, collective action, representation, and social change.

From the fight for voting rights to contemporary movements for equality, justice, and inclusion, women have often been at the forefront of efforts to strengthen democratic values and expand opportunities for participation.

Kawartha Art Gallery welcomes works that challenge perspectives, commemorate achievements, inspire dialogue, or imagine a future where all people can participate fully in civic and community life.

Participation can be expressed in many ways…a raised hand, an open door, a gathering of voices, a bridge built between communities, a path forward, an act of courage, or a vision of change.

This theme offers powerful opportunities for metaphor and symbolism, and artists are encouraged to consider both tangible and symbolic representations of participation and democracy through the following themes:

  • Democracy
  • Advocacy
  • Leadership
  • Human Rights
  • Identity
  • Protest
  • Belonging
  • Representation
  • Community Engagement

Artists are invited to interpret the theme through personal experiences, historical narratives, contemporary issues, or imagined futures. Whether reflective, celebratory, provocative, or aspirational, submissions should approach the subject with sensitivity, authenticity, and creative intention

Eligibility

  • Open to all artists 18 years and older living within Ontario
  • One entry per Artist
  • Maximum size of artwork 48in wide x 72in tall
  • Cost per entry for Gallery Member Artists is $35.00
  • Cost per entry for non-Gallery Member Artist is $50.00
  • All entry fees are non-refundable
  • All works to have been completed with the past 24 months
  • Each entry to include an Artist statement. This is an explanation of your overall vision and the issues/ideas that you have presented in your work (maximum 300-word count)
  • Each entry to include two good quality images of the submitted piece of work with submitted images in a 300 dpi in JPG (or JPEG) format. With image files not exceeding 2.5MB
  • Image files submitted with entry form are to be named using the following convention: FirstName, LastName, Title of Work, Date of Work, Format (i.e.: Jane Doe, Title,.jpg)
  • Mediums welcomed are painting, drawing, printmaking, mixed media, sculpture, textile and fibre art, photography and digital art
  • No AI generated works will be accepted
  • Artists are responsible for the transportation of accepted artworks to and from the Gallery
  • The Gallery assumes insurance responsibility only while works are onsite
  • All works must be delivered ready to install, d-hooks and wire
  • Works selected for the exhibition must remain on view for the full duration of the exhibit
  • By submitting, artists agree to allow the Gallery to use images of selected works for promotional purposes
  • The Gallery reserves the right to decline any artwork that does not meet the exhibition standards or eligibility criteria

Awards

  • Highest Achievement – $1,000.00
  • Award of Merit – $500.00
  • Award of Distinction – $250.00
  • Award of Distinction – $250.00

Jurying

Notification of acceptance will be sent via email on Saturday, October 3, 2026.

The juror’s decision is final. Only work that has been accepted by the juror will be included in the exhibition.

All works not accepted will be required to be picked up from the Gallery on Monday, October 5, 2026, between 11am and 5pm.
